NVC Foundation TrainingPosted mars 13th, 2008 by dd083Date: 2008-05-17 10:00 - 2008-05-18 17:30 Trainer(s): Location(s)Holborn London, LNDUnited Kingdom Preparation: Read "Nonviolent Communication: A Language of Life" by Marshall Rosenberg, PhD Contact Person: Course Description: This is a 2-day non-residential foundation training in NVC. Our aim is to support you to acquire a clear basic understanding of the NVC process and how you can use it in your daily life - in personal, social or work situations. We intend to do this by outlining the main elements of NVC and providing opportunities for you to practice expressing them in different contexts - out loud, through writing and through role-play in small groups of 2 or 3. We see this course as providing a 'foundation' for you, so that you can progress with NVC in your daily life and in further trainings if you so desire.
